Brazil is the 37th export destination for Sri Lanka. Total export value from Sri Lanka to Brazil was USD 73.50 Mn in 2025 and total imports from Brazil to Sri Lanka for the same period were USD 126 Mn Brazil is the 24th import origin for Sri Lanka in 2025.
Sri Lanka’s exports to Brazil have decreased by 13.22% in 2025 when compared to the year 2024. Imports from Brazil has increased by 77.46% in 2025 when compared to the year 2024.
Sri Lanka’s main export products to Brazil in 2025 were Pneumatic & Retreated Rubber Tyres & Tubes, Industrial & Surgical Gloves of Rubber, Women's Outerwear, Gloves, Mitts & Mittens of Textile, Petroleum Oils, Men's and Women's Under Garments, Men's Outerwear, Other Electrical & Electronic Products, Activated Carbon, and T-shirts.
